To the best of my knowledge, there's no way to make the folder list longer.

As for adding bookmarks, the reason that the "Save this bookmark" option isn't in your screenshot appears to be because you already have the page bookmarked. That's why you have the "Edit this bookmark" option instead.

You can tell it's bookmarked because the star in the Firefox address bar is blue. If the page was not already in your bookmarks, it would be just a grey outline star.

A good tip as well is that you can simply click that star to either add a page to the bookmarks or edit the bookmark, instead of going through the Library drop-down menu.
